Output 8364ebffb1f3fd95b462859945c1abe5d0e19cc7d64682fd966022ab5ec26760:0

value
130646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69d5331f237ea854fef57e186993e8db18750212 OP_EQUAL
address
3BLcH4TMZrEC4xMaYpqL9PoUefLNLsVaDg
transaction
8364ebffb1f3fd95b462859945c1abe5d0e19cc7d64682fd966022ab5ec26760
spent
true